    Abstract: An approach to enhance the noise immunity of high-speed digital signals by means of a resonance-free environment is developed. Resonance detuning is achieved by appropriately reshaping the layout of the power/ground planes. Resonant properties of the power distribution system, including resonant frequencies and field distribution profiles, were characterized with frequency-domain simulations. Analysis of the resonant field profiles reveals that the electric field distribution of the dominant mode normally concentrates in the vicinity of the plane edge. Therefore, resonance can be effectively tuned out of the operating frequency range through boundary configuring. In addition, it is shown that variation of the quality factor with the external probe position provides a means to monitor and construct the resonant field distribution. Physical mechanism responsible for this unique property is clarified from the perspective of probe coupling.

    Abstract: An apparatus comprising an acoustically resonant ultrasound launcher is provided for cleaning of optical fiber connectors and other optical fiber parts. The resonant ultrasound launcher is designed to transfer and to focus ultrasonic energy from an ultrasound transducer to a relatively small target area with high intensity. Specially designed fluid flow channels allow this apparatus to efficiently clean optical fiber connectors with an exposed end surface or with an end surface concealed in a connector adapter. Circuitry is provided to automatically track the frequency to enhance the ultrasound generation. Another circuitry is provided to program the sequence of the cleaning process, including washing, rinsing and drying.

    Abstract: A light emitting diode package structure includes an insulating carrier base formed with a recess or a through hole. The recess or the through hole has a depth enough for completely accommodating a light emitting diode. The recess or the through hole may have two stepwise portions for providing two intermediate mesa planes. Two planar metal layers are separately formed on the two intermediate mesa planes and, respectively, connected to two metal pads which are arranged outside of the recess or the through hole. Two wiring lines connect two electrodes of the light emitting diode with the two planar metal layers, respectively. A resin fills the recess or the through hole for sealing all of the light emitting diode and the two wiring lines.

    Abstract: A digital signal processor includes a byte direct memory access (DMA) controller and an external memory controller, both of which are coupled to each other. The external memory controller is coupled to a byte memory and other external memories through a common data bus. The byte DMA controller performs a byte DMA operation to the byte memory through the common data bus by controlling the external memory, thereby avoiding an additional data bus. As a result, the digital signal processor according to the present invention has less connecting terminals and achieves a size reduction.
